Actions to Stop Divorce: A Practical Roadmap for Couples in Crisis

Facing the potential end of your marriage can be incredibly painful and overwhelming.
But before you decide to call it quits, take a moment to analyze your situation honestly. Divorce is a major life change with far-reaching consequences for both individuals and any children involved. If you're willing to put in the effort, there are
concrete steps you can take to rebuild your relationship and avoid divorce.

  • Initiate by having an open and honest talk with your significant other. Express your feelings, concerns, and listen attentively to theirs.
  • Look for professional help from a therapist or counselor. They can provide guidance as you work through difficult issues.
  • Develop empathy and understanding for your partner's perspective, even if you don't concur their viewpoint.
  • Concentrate on rebuilding intimacy in your relationship through quality time and meaningful interactions.
  • Create clear and healthy boundaries to protect both your emotional well-being and the integrity of the relationship.
  • Pledge to working together as a team, even when facing challenges. Remember that you are in this as one.
  • Resolve underlying issues that may be contributing to the conflict. This could involve financial problems, communication breakdowns, or unresolved past hurts.
  • Acquire new interaction skills to express yourselves effectively and resolve disagreements constructively.
  • Forgive any past hurts and cultivate a spirit of reconciliation. Holding onto anger and resentment will only hinder your progress.
  • Take consistent endeavor to maintain the positive changes you have made. Remember that building a strong and lasting relationship takes ongoing dedication.
